The Environmental Test Technician (2nd Shift) joins the Enterprise Test Capabilities team to execute a wide range of climatic and environmental tests on various products. This role involves performing thermal, dynamic, corrosion, and ingress testing while programming test controllers like WATLOW F4s and F4Ts. The technician will set up data acquisition systems, maintain lab spaces, manage capital equipment such as environmental chambers and electrodynamic shakers, and update technical documentation. Key requirements include over seven years of experience in an engineering technician capacity, familiarity with Jira, and knowledge of MIL-STD-810 or DO-160 standards. Preferred skills include proficiency with NI data acquisition systems, LabVIEW, Flexlogger, and specialized software like VibrationVIEW and ObserVIEW. The role focuses on providing critical environmental testing to validate complex hardware across multiple programs within a defense technology context.
